Cecil College
Cecil College
Cecil College is a highly-rated institution offering comprehensive trade programs with strong job placement rates, industry-recognized certifications, and hands-on training. Students benefit from experienced instructors and modern facilities, with many programs designed for quick entry into high-demand fields like welding, HVAC, and automotive technology. The college serves Cecil County and surrounding areas, including Conowingo.

What certifications can I earn through trade schools near Conowingo, MD, for fields like HVAC or electrical work?
Programs at Cecil College and Harford Community College prepare students for certifications such as EPA 608 for HVAC-R, NCCER credentials for electrical trades, and ASE certifications for automotive service. These are industry-recognized credentials that enhance employability in the local and regional job market.
How do trade school programs in the Conowingo area connect with local employers?
Trade schools like Cecil College and Harford Community College maintain strong relationships with employers in Cecil and Harford counties through job fairs, internship programs, and advisory boards. Local companies in manufacturing, construction, and automotive services often recruit directly from these programs, providing a direct pipeline to employment.
What financial aid options are available for trade school students in Conowingo, MD?
Students in Conowingo can access federal financial aid, Maryland state grants, and scholarships through schools like Cecil College and Harford Community College. Additionally, some local employers and trade unions offer tuition assistance or sponsorship for students pursuing in-demand trades like welding or electrical systems.
